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the field of riveting machine technology, and in particular to a riveting device. Background Technology
[0002] Traditional riveting machines can only rivet one type of rivet, resulting in low riveting efficiency. When riveting two different types of rivets, operators have to manually change the upper and lower riveting heads, which wastes a lot of time and affects production efficiency. Utility Model Content
[0003] This invention aims to solve at least one of the technical problems existing in the prior art. To this end, this invention proposes a riveting device that can improve production efficiency.
[0004] The riveting device according to an embodiment of the present invention includes:
[0005] frame;
[0006] A support platform is movably mounted on the frame. The support platform is used to support the workpiece to be riveted. The support platform is connected to a first drive assembly, which is used to drive the support platform to move.
[0007] A first feeding assembly is disposed on the frame, and the first feeding assembly is used to feed the first rivet onto the workpiece;
[0008] A second feeding assembly is provided on the frame, and the second feeding assembly is used to feed the second rivet onto the workpiece;
[0009] The first riveting assembly includes a first driving member, a first upper riveting head, and a first lower riveting head. The first lower riveting head is disposed on the frame, and the first upper riveting head is disposed on the frame and can move in a direction close to or away from the first lower riveting head. The first driving member is used to drive the first upper riveting head to move so as to rivet the first rivet.
[0010] The second riveting assembly includes a second driving member, a second upper riveting head, and a second lower riveting head. The second lower riveting head is disposed on the frame, and the second upper riveting head is disposed on the frame and can move in a direction close to or away from the second lower riveting head. The second driving member is used to drive the second upper riveting head to move in order to rivet the second rivet.
[0011] The riveting device according to the embodiments of this utility model has at least the following beneficial effects:
[0012] When the riveting equipment is working, the first drive assembly drives the support table to move so that the first riveting position of the workpiece is located below the first upper riveting head. The first feeding assembly delivers the first rivet to the first riveting position of the workpiece. The first drive member drives the first upper riveting head to move downward to rivet the first rivet at the first riveting position of the workpiece. Then, the first drive assembly drives the support table to move so that the second riveting position of the workpiece is located below the second upper riveting head. The second feeding assembly delivers the second rivet to the second riveting position of the workpiece. The second drive member drives the second upper riveting head to move downward to rivet the second rivet at the second riveting position of the workpiece. This allows for the riveting of two different specifications of rivets, solving the problem that traditional riveting equipment can only rivet one type of rivet and improving the production efficiency of the riveting equipment.

[0035] In related technologies, traditional riveting machines can only rivet one type of rivet, resulting in low riveting efficiency. When riveting two different types of rivets, operators have to manually change the upper and lower riveting heads, which wastes a lot of time and affects production efficiency.
[0036] Reference Figures 1 to 5 According to an embodiment of the present invention, a riveting device includes a frame 100, a support platform 200, a first feeding assembly 300, a second feeding assembly, a first riveting assembly 500, and a second riveting assembly 600. The support platform 200 is movably disposed on the frame 100 and is used to support the workpiece to be riveted. The support platform 200 is connected to a first driving assembly, which is used to drive the support platform 200 to move. The first feeding assembly 300 is disposed on the frame 100 and is used to feed a first rivet onto the workpiece. The second feeding assembly is disposed on the frame 100 and is used to feed a second rivet onto the workpiece. The first riveting assembly 500 includes a first driving member 510, a first upper riveting head 520, and a first lower riveting head 530. The first upper riveting head 520 is mounted on the frame 100 and can move towards or away from the first lower riveting head 530. The first driving member 510 is used to drive the first upper riveting head 520 to move in order to rivet the first rivet. The second riveting assembly 600 includes a second driving member 610, a second upper riveting head 620, and a second lower riveting head 630. The second lower riveting head 630 is mounted on the frame 100, and the second upper riveting head 620 is mounted on the frame 100 and can move towards or away from the second lower riveting head 630. The second driving member 610 is used to drive the second upper riveting head 620 to move in order to rivet the second rivet. This assembly can rivet two different specifications of rivets, solving the problem that traditional riveting equipment can only rivet one specification of rivet and improving the production efficiency of the riveting equipment.
[0037] For example, when the riveting equipment is working, the first drive assembly drives the support table 200 to move so that the first riveting position of the workpiece is below the first upper riveting head 520. The first feeding assembly 300 feeds the first rivet to the first riveting position of the workpiece. The first drive member 510 drives the first upper riveting head 520 to move downward to rivet the first rivet at the first riveting position of the workpiece. Then, the first drive assembly drives the support table 200 to move so that the second riveting position of the workpiece is below the second upper riveting head 620. The second feeding assembly feeds the second rivet to the second riveting position of the workpiece. The second drive member 610 drives the second upper riveting head 620 to move downward to rivet the second rivet at the second riveting position of the workpiece. This can realize the riveting of two different specifications of rivets, solving the problem that traditional riveting equipment can only rivet one specification of rivet and improving the production efficiency of the riveting equipment.
[0038] It should be noted that the first rivet and the second rivet have different specifications, that is, the first rivet and the second rivet are different in size, but this is not a limitation here.
[0039] In some embodiments of this utility model, the first drive assembly includes a first slide 710, a second slide 720, and a third slide 730. The first slide 710 is movably disposed on the frame 100 and is connected to a third drive member 740. The second slide 720 is movably disposed on the first slide 710 and is connected to a fourth drive member 750. The third slide 730 is movably disposed on the second slide 720 and is connected to a fifth drive member 760. The support platform 200 is disposed on the third slide 730. The moving directions of the first slide 710, the second slide 720, and the third slide 730 are staggered, enabling the support platform 200 to achieve three-axis movement.
[0040] For example, the first slide 710 can move in the front-back direction, the third drive member 740 can drive the first slide 710 to move in the front-back direction, the second slide 720 can move in the left-right direction, the fourth drive member 750 can drive the second slide 720 to move in the left-right direction, the third slide 730 can move in the up-down direction, and the fifth drive member 760 can drive the third slide 730 to move in the up-down direction, so that the support platform 200 can achieve three-axis movement.
[0041] It should be noted that the first drive component can also be a three-axis robot or a four-axis robot, etc., without limitation.
[0042] In some embodiments of this utility model, a second driving component is also included. The second lower riveting head 630 can move in a direction close to or away from the second upper riveting head 620. The second driving component is used to drive the second lower riveting head 630 to move, which can avoid interference between the second lower riveting head 630 and the support table 200, thereby riveting the first rivet at the first riveting position of the workpiece.
[0043] For example, the length of the first rivet is greater than that of the second rivet. When the first driving member 510 presses the first rivet at the first pressing position of the workpiece, the second driving component drives the second lower pressing head 630 to descend. When the second driving member 610 presses the second rivet at the second pressing position of the workpiece, the second driving component drives the second lower pressing head 630 to rise, so that the second lower pressing head 630 can press and support the second rivet, thus avoiding interference between the second lower pressing head 630 and the support table 200, thereby pressing the first rivet at the first pressing position of the workpiece.
[0044] In some embodiments of this utility model, the second driving assembly includes a sixth driving member 820 and a fourth slide 810. The fourth slide 810 is movably disposed on the frame 100. The sixth driving member 820 is used to drive the fourth slide 810 to move. The moving direction of the fourth slide 810 is staggered with the moving direction of the second pressing riveting head 630. A transmission structure is provided between the fourth slide 810 and the second pressing riveting head 630. The fourth slide 810 drives the second pressing riveting head 630 to move through the transmission structure, so that the sixth driving member 820 does not need to bear the load of the second pressing riveting head 630, thereby improving the service life of the sixth driving member 820.
[0045] For example, the fourth slide block 810 can move in the left and right direction. When the second driving member 610 presses the second rivet at the second pressing position of the workpiece, the sixth driving member 820 moves through the fourth slide block 810. The fourth slide block 810 lifts the second lower pressing head 630 through the transmission structure, so that the sixth driving member 820 does not have to bear the load of the second lower pressing head 630, thereby improving the service life of the sixth driving member 820.
[0046] It should be noted that the second drive assembly may also include only the sixth drive unit 820. The output end of the sixth drive unit 820 is directly connected to the fourth slide 810 and can also drive the fourth slide 810 to move. This is not a limitation.
[0047] In some embodiments of this utility model, the transmission structure includes an inclined surface 811 provided on the fourth slide 810 and a roller 631 provided on the second pressing rivet head 630. The roller 631 rolls against the inclined surface 811, so that the fourth slide 810 can lift the second pressing rivet head 630.
[0048] For example, roller 631 is rotatably disposed at the lower end of the second pressing head 630. When the fourth slide 810 moves, roller 631 rolls on the inclined surface 811, so that the fourth slide 810 can lift the second pressing head 630.
[0049] As another implementation, the transmission structure can also be a gear and rack transmission structure, which is not limited here.
[0050] In some embodiments of this utility model, the fourth slide block 810 is provided with a support plane 812, which is connected to the inclined plane 811. When the first pressing rivet head 530 presses the second rivet, the roller 631 abuts against the support plane 812, which can stably support the second pressing rivet head 630.
[0051] In some embodiments of this utility model, a guide structure is provided between the second pressing riveting head 630 and the frame 100, which can guide the second pressing riveting head 630, thereby improving the movement stability of the second pressing riveting head 630.
[0052] In some embodiments of this utility model, the guide structure includes a guide rail 910 disposed on the frame 100 and a guide member 920 disposed on the second pressing riveting head 630. The guide member 920 is provided with a guide groove, and the guide rail 910 passes through the guide groove, which can guide the second pressing riveting head 630, thereby improving the movement stability of the second pressing riveting head 630.
[0053] It should be noted that the positions of the guide rail 910 and the guide component 920 can be interchanged. For example, the guide rail 910 can be located on the second pressing head 630, and the guide component 920 can be located on the frame 100. No restrictions are imposed here.
[0054] It should be noted that the guide structure can also be a linear bearing, and there are no restrictions here.
[0055] In some embodiments of this utility model, the first feeding assembly 300 includes a first vibratory plate 310 and a feeding seat 320. The feeding seat 320 is provided with a first feeding hole 321. The discharge end of the first vibratory plate 310 is connected to the first feeding hole 321 through a pipe. The diameter of the first upper pressing riveting head 520 is larger than the diameter of the first feeding hole 321. The feeding seat 320 is movably disposed on the frame 100. The feeding seat 320 is connected to a seventh driving member 330. The seventh driving member 330 is used for... The feeder 320 is moved so that it can be located below or not below the first upper rivet head 520. When the feeder 320 is located below the first upper rivet head 520, the first feed hole 321 is coaxially arranged with the first lower rivet head 530. On the one hand, this can avoid interference between the first upper rivet head 520 and the feeder 320. On the other hand, it can ensure that the first upper rivet head 520 can stably push the first rivet.
[0056] For example, the first rivet in the first vibratory plate 310 is transported to the first feeding hole 321 through a pipe. When the seventh driving member 330 drives the feeding seat 320 to move between the first upper pressing head 520 and the first lower pressing head 530, the first rivet in the first feeding hole 321 falls into the first pressing position of the workpiece. After that, the feeding seat 320 is retracted so that the feeding seat 320 is not located between the first upper pressing head 520 and the first lower pressing head 530, which can avoid interference between the first upper pressing head 520 and the feeding seat 320. Then, the first driving member 510 drives the first upper pressing head 520 to move downward until the first rivet abuts. Since the diameter of the first upper pressing head 520 is larger than the diameter of the first feeding hole 321, it is ensured that the first upper pressing head 520 can stably push the first rivet.
[0057] In another implementation, the first feeding assembly 300 can also transport the first rivet by a belt or a robotic arm, which will not be described in detail here.
[0058] In some embodiments of this utility model, the second feeding assembly includes a second vibratory plate 410 and a feeding track 420. The feeding track 420 is provided with a second feeding hole. The discharge end of the second vibratory plate 410 is connected to the feeding track 420. The diameter of the second upper riveting head 620 is smaller than the diameter of the second feeding hole. The second feeding hole is located between the second upper riveting head 620 and the second lower riveting head 630, and the second feeding hole and the second lower riveting head 630 are coaxially arranged, which can realize the automatic feeding of the second rivet, thereby improving the automation level of the riveting equipment.
